Signed by W.H. Eccles as President. Utah, 1907, 6% 1st Mortgage Gold Coupon Bond, Locomotive passing telephone pole, POC, coupons removed, gold foil seal, VF condition, S/N 815, . William H. Eccles, a key member of the influential Eccles industrial family, was a prominent lumberman and railroad executive whose interests helped shape the economic development of the Pacific Northwest. Best known for his leadership as President of the Mount Hood Railroad Company, he played a major role in expanding regional timber and transportation networks. Though his own work centered on lumber and railroads, the broader Eccles family was deeply involved in the Western sugar industry, most notably through his brother David Eccles, a founder of the Amalgamated Sugar Company. �������������������������������������������������������������������������������� Est. $60-100 647 647 UT.
